Pros of Smart Pet Devices

1. Convenience

One of the biggest reasons people buy smart pet devices is convenience. Automatic feeding schedules, app controls, and self-cleaning systems reduce the amount of daily work required to care for pets.

Busy pet owners especially benefit from devices that automate routines and help maintain consistency even when schedules become unpredictable.

2. Better Monitoring

Smart pet cameras allow owners to monitor pets remotely using live video and two-way audio. Some devices also include motion alerts, barking notifications, and treat dispensers.

This can provide peace of mind for owners who spend long hours away from home or travel frequently.

3. Improved Pet Health

Devices such as water fountains and automatic feeders can help improve hydration and feeding consistency. Better routines often support healthier habits for pets over time.

Smart feeding schedules can also help control portions and prevent overeating.

Cons of Smart Pet Devices

1. Higher Cost

Many smart pet devices cost more than traditional pet products. Advanced features such as app support, cameras, sensors, and automation increase overall pricing.

Some products may also require replacement filters, subscription services, or maintenance parts over time.

2. Dependence on WiFi and Power

Most smart pet devices depend on internet connections or electrical power to function properly. If WiFi disconnects or power goes out, some features may stop working temporarily.

3. Learning Curve

Some smart devices require setup, app pairing, and occasional troubleshooting. Less tech-focused users may prefer simpler products without advanced features.

Buying Guide

Your Pet’s Needs

Not every pet requires smart technology. Consider whether your pet actually benefits from features such as automatic feeding, monitoring, or self-cleaning systems.

Ease of Use

Choose devices with simple controls and reliable mobile apps. Complicated systems can become frustrating over time.

Maintenance Requirements

Some smart devices require regular filter changes, tray replacements, or cleaning. Understanding long-term maintenance costs is important before buying.

Compatibility

Check whether the device works with your home setup, WiFi connection, or preferred smart home ecosystem.
